David Fitzpatrick CPA, CA, is a Partner with MNP in Thunder Bay. David is a passionate advisor to small- and medium-sized businesses who works closely with business owners and their teams to capitalize on the opportunities of today for a better, more prosperous future.

David is committed to gaining a deep understanding of his clients’ businesses and exceeding client expectations. He is responsible for tax and remuneration planning and oversight of tax filings, working exclusively in the area of domestic tax with a focus on corporate and personal tax planning and corporate restructuring. He also delivers services related to corporate finance, governance and succession planning.

David leads the region in helping clients with the intergenerational transfer of family businesses.

He works with a broad range of owner-managers in a variety of industries, including automotive, professional services, real estate and construction.

David earned an Honours Bachelor of Commerce (BComm) from Queen’s University. He is a Chartered Professional Accountant (CPA), qualifying as a Chartered Accountant (CA), and has completed the CPA In-Depth Tax Course.

Involved in his community, David currently sits as a board member and finance chair for the Thunder Bay Kings AAA Hockey Association.
